‘Titans’ Season Two Adds Natalie Gumede to Play Mercy Graves

Jun 13, 2019

The second season of the DC Universe series ‘Titans’ has cast Natalie Gumede to play Mercy Graves. She will be a recurring guest star.

Gumede is popular for her role in the ‘Doctor Who Christmas Special’ from 2014. She’s also been part of several other BBC series, such as ‘Ideal,’ ‘Death in Paradise,’ and ‘Jekyll & Hyde.’ Meanwhile, she is currently in the Netflix series ‘Free Rein,’ which has its third season premiering July 6th.

Additionally, the character’s official description is below:

“Mercy Graves is the ruthless, cunning, right hand and bodyguard to the notorious Lex Luthor – serving her boss with unquestioned loyalty. Her connection to the Luthors runs deep, as Mercy has been a friend of the family and in Lex’s life since they were young.”

Moreover, ‘Titans’ hails from Greg Walker and Geoff Johns. Season two includes returning cast members Brenton Thwaites, Anna Diop, Ryan Potter, Teagan Croft, and Curran Walters. Newcomers comprise of Joshua Orpin, Chella Man, Chelsea Zhang, Esai Morales, and Iain Glen.

Further, the second season will premiere this fall, with John Fawcett (‘Orphan Black’) directing the pilot.
